 Course Description  

Use SketchUp� is a 3D drawing software program used to create 3D models. Learn how to explore the SketchUp interface and tools to create 3D models. Also learn how to use SketchUp� Layout to create prints of your drawings and SketchUp Viewer to view your 3D models on mobile devices.

Learning Outcomes

After completing this course, the student will be able to:

  1. Navigate Sketchup interface. Identify and use core tools for creating models
  2. Create, review and edit 3-D Models. Convert 2-D drawings to 3-D Models. Access materials library and 3D Warehouse to import models.
